RICCE Enhances Local Farmers’ Knowledge on sustainable farming Practices in Commemoration of World Environment Day

In commemoration of World Environmental Day, the Rural Integrated Center for Community Empowerment (RICCE) strengthened the capacities of Green Land Farmers Corporation (GLFC), a local farmer group predominantly women, and the Coalition of Upliftment, Resilience, and Empowerment (CURE) on climate-smart agriculture practices that supports environmental sustainability and conservation. RICCE: Advocating for Stronger Rural Liberian Communities

Brief History On August 5, 2005, the organization RICCE was founded by development specialists, Engineers, health professionals, grassroots activists, and some professors at the University of Liberia who were alarmed by the exclusion of rural people especially women participation in decision making about national issues which have impacts on their lives.
